Remifentanil-propofol analgo-sedation shortens duration of ventilation and length of ICU stay compared to a conventional regimen: a centre randomised, cross-over, open-label study in the Netherlands.

Author(s): Rozendaal FW, Spronk PE, Snellen FF, Schoen A, van Zanten AR, Foudraine NA, Mulder PG, Bakker J, UltiSAFE investigators

Affiliation(s): Jeroen Bosch Hospital, 's-Hertogenbosch, The Netherlands.

Publication date & source: 2009-02, Intensive Care Med., 35(2):291-8. Epub 2008 Oct 24.

Publication type: Comparative Study; Randomized Controlled Trial; Research Support, Non-U.S. Gov't

OBJECTIVE: Compare duration of mechanical ventilation (MV), weaning time, ICU-LOS (ICU-LOS), efficacy and safety of remifentanil-based regimen with conventional sedation and analgesia. DESIGN: Centre randomised, open-label, crossover, 'real-life' study. SETTING: 15 Dutch hospitals. PATIENTS: Adult medical and post-surgical ICU patients with anticipated short-term (2-3 days) MV. INTERVENTIONS: Patient cohorts were randomised to remifentanil-based regimen (n = 96) with propofol as required, for a maximum of 10 days, or to conventional regimens (n = 109) of propofol, midazolam or lorazepam combined with fentanyl or morphine. MEASUREMENTS AND MAIN RESULTS: Outcomes were weaning time, duration of MV, ICU-LOS, sedation- and analgesia levels, intensivist/ICU nurse satisfaction, adverse events, mean arterial pressure, heart rate. Median duration of ventilation (MV) was 5.1 days with conventional treatment versus 3.9 days with remifentanil (NS). The remifentanil-based regimen reduced median weaning time by 18.9 h (P = 0.0001). Median ICU-LOS was 7.9 days versus 5.9 days, respectively (NS). However, the treatment effects on duration of MV and ICU stay were time-dependent: patients were almost twice as likely to be extubated (P = 0.018) and discharged from the ICU (P = 0.05) on day 1-3. Propofol doses were reduced by 20% (P = 0.05). Remifentanil also improved sedation-agitation scores (P < 0.0001) and intensivist/ICU nurse satisfaction (P < 0.0001). All other outcomes were comparable. CONCLUSIONS: In patients with an expected short-term duration of MV, remifentanil significantly improves sedation and agitation levels and reduces weaning time. This contributes to a shorter duration of MV and ICU-LOS.
